Recent observational data on solar flares are summarized, and possible interpretations are evaluated. The data include results of magnetic-field observations, hard and soft X-ray observations, and microwave observations. The main properties of solar flares are reviewed, the process of magnetic-field annihilation is analyzed, and some difficulties with the hypothesis of magnetic-field annihilation as the energy source for solar flares are considered. Two particle-acceleration mechanisms associated with solar flares are examined: runaway-electron production in more or less normal electric fields and stochastic acceleration by plasma turbulence, especially the modulational instability. The roles of shock waves and current sheets in the solar-flare phenomenon are briefly discussed.
